What is the Colorado Special Warranty
The Colorado special warranty is a legal document used in real estate transactions. It serves as a type of deed that conveys property ownership while limiting the liability of the seller. This warranty assures the buyer that the seller holds title to the property and has the right to sell it, but it does not guarantee against any claims or defects that may have arisen during the seller's ownership. The special warranty deed is particularly useful for sellers who want to protect themselves from future claims related to the property.
How to use the Colorado Special Warranty
Using the Colorado special warranty involves several key steps. First, the seller must prepare the deed, ensuring all necessary information is included, such as the legal description of the property and the names of the parties involved. Next, both the seller and buyer should review the document carefully to confirm accuracy. Once satisfied, the seller must sign the deed in the presence of a notary public. After notarization, the deed should be filed with the appropriate county clerk and recorder to make the transfer official.

Key elements of the Colorado Special Warranty
Several key elements define the Colorado special warranty. These include:
- Grantor and Grantee: The parties involved in the transaction, where the grantor is the seller and the grantee is the buyer.
- Property Description: A detailed legal description of the property being conveyed.
- Warranty Clause: A statement that the grantor warrants the title against claims arising only during their ownership.
- Notary Acknowledgment: A section for the notary to verify the identities of the signers.

State-specific rules for the Colorado Special Warranty
Colorado has specific rules that govern the use of special warranty deeds. These rules include the necessity of including a legal description of the property and ensuring that the deed is signed and notarized. Additionally, Colorado law requires that the deed be recorded in the county where the property is located to provide public notice of the transfer. Failure to comply with these regulations may result in challenges to the validity of the deed.

What is a Colorado Special Warranty and how does it work?
A Colorado Special Warranty is a specific type of deed that conveys property with a limited warranty of title. This means the seller guarantees that they have not encumbered the property during their ownership, but does not assure the buyer of the title's history prior to their ownership. This type of warranty is commonly used in real estate transactions to provide a balance of protection for both buyers and sellers.
